Catalog description

This course explores high-level issues of autonomous robotics. The course will focus on theory, design, and implementation of making intelligent and autonomous robots. The course will examine these topics from the perspective of individual robots, swarm robots, and multi-agent robots. Students will learn both theory and practice through simulations and work on robot platforms. Prerequisites: ECPE 170 or ECPE 172 or MECH 104 with a “C“ or better and Graduate or blended students in the School of Engineering and Computer Science.
